Transaction 073375cd9bf60b658d51344797314214fb27cb85ce45fe572f41f347d18c291b
1 Input
2 Outputs
- 073375cd9bf60b658d51344797314214fb27cb85ce45fe572f41f347d18c291b:0
- 073375cd9bf60b658d51344797314214fb27cb85ce45fe572f41f347d18c291b:1
value 46048
address 1HNSFPq3BMQTo97bbpAbuHb7uywNapv4Qu
value 2888166
address 1Jy3BxWmmbRa9oqugZe9fLrqgkNEGVQyC